Opinion

It is ordered and adjudged that said petition in error be, and the same hereby is, dismissed for the reason no debatable constitutional question is involved in said cause.

Petition in error dismissed.

Marshall, C. J., Day, Allen, Kinkade, Jones and Matthias, JJ., concur. Robinson, J., not participating.
